Tour Tanah Lot | Hours & Best Time to Photograph Bali’s Scenic Temple

Tanah Lot is a beautiful rock formation located off the coast of Bali and home to Pura Tanah Lot, or Tanah Lot Temple, one of the most visited temples in Bali. In addition to being a popular destination for photography-savvy visitors, the temple is a Hindu pilgrimage site and one of seven temples that line the Balinese coast. While Tahah Lot and the rock formation are the major reasons tourists stop in the area, there also are plenty of other attractions nearby. Visitors can combine sightseeing at Tahah Lot with visits to Beraban Village, Pura Batu Bolong, another beautiful sea temple, as well as many gorgeous beaches in Bali.

Best time to visit Tanah Lot

A visit to the iconic cultural landmark of Tanah Lot is on the top of many tourists’ sightseeing lists, and because the site is so popular, it is a good idea for visitors to plan ahead in order to maximize their time and enjoyment in the area.

Low season in Bali is considered to be between mid-January until the end of June and from mid-September to mid-December. During low season, travelers can expect shorter lines and fewer people at popular sites, as well as better deals on hotels and flights. However, the weather is known for being a bit rainy during some of this time, so plan ahead and take an umbrella or proper rain gear. Generally, the rain consists of midday downpours, so travelers may be able to plan around the rain. It is also recommended that visitors check the calendar for any religious or public holidays as special celebrations and pilgrimages also increase foot traffic to the temple.

While any time of the day is nice for a visit to Tanah Lot Temple, many people prefer to go an hour or so before the sun sets so that they can take in the gorgeous colors that shimmer across the water. Travelers looking to avoid crowds should go early in the morning during the week. The temple is less crowded during midday, as well, but afternoon weather can be quite hot. Weekends are generally pretty busy, and visitors should check tide schedules because the temple is not accessible during high tides.

What to wear

As with many important holy sites, visitors should dress modestly in clothing that covers the shoulders and the knees when visiting Tanah Lot Temple. The temple has a strict dress code for men and women; however, foreign tourists are not allowed inside the temple proper, as only Balinese nationals are allowed inside. When visiting the rock formation, there is no formal dress code. Dressing modestly in the area, however, is recommended.

Hours and admission price to Tanah Lot

Entrance Fee: Foreigners pay a premium fee to visit Tanah Lot. The cost for adult foreign nationals is 60,000 IDR and the cost for foreign children is 30,000 IDR. For Indonesian nationals, the cost for adults is 20,000 IDR, and the cost for children is 15,000 IDR.

Hours of Operation: 7 a.m. to 7 p.m. daily

How to Get to Tanah Lot

Tanah Lot is located on the coast in South Bali and many visitors will opt for a tour to visit the area. Booking a tour with a guide can be a great way to travel to the temple, and there are smaller buses and transportation shuttles available as well.

Taking a taxi is another option. Travelers should be able to hail a taxi at the hotel where they are staying, or taxis are available from Ngurah Rai International Airport for travelers who want to head directly to Tanah Lot.

Tanah Lot is located a little more than an hour from the airport and about an hour from Denpasar, the capital city.

Best Things to do Near Tanah Lot

Many people go to Tanah Lot to see the temple, but visitors should remember to add the other interesting sights in the area to their itineraries.

Batu Bolong Temple

Located just north of Tanah Lot is Pura Batu Bolong, a beautiful Hindu temple that also sits atop a rockcliff overlook. Pura Batu Bolong is accessible by a long walkway. Visitors who are hoping to take some beautiful photographs should time their visits for either sunrise or sunset. Sunset may be particularly busy, so tourists who are looking to avoid crowds should keep this in mind.

Entrance fees for Pura Batu Bolong are by donation, but officials may suggest a specific minimum amount for visitors. Hours are from 7 a.m. to 7 p.m. daily.

Canggu

About 20 minutes southeast of Tanah Lot is Canggu, a resort village known for beautiful beaches, high-end shops, and a strong surf. If travelers are looking for a base for their visit to Tanah Lot, Canggu is a great option. Between resorts and other hotels, there are plenty of places to stay and tons of delicious restaurants to eat at. The area is also a great place to experience some nightlife activities.

Batu Bolong Beach

Located near all the action in Canggu, Batu Bolong Beach is popular with tourists who congregate close to sunset as the beach is known for being a great place to take photos. It is also conveniently located near many popular restaurants and bars, plus Love Anchor, a busy market that sells everything from jewelry to clothing.

Love Anchor is open from 9 a.m. to 9 p.m. daily.
